## Deployment

Quick heads-up for new folks: the Tallow report builder guarantees stable sorting, so rows with equal keys keep their original order. Don't "optimize" the comparator — downstream exports in Fernby depend on that behavior. Deploys are blue-green; run the sort-stability smoke test before flipping traffic. The builder reads the following configuration values at deploy time.

config for tawif-bagef:
[sorwyn]
team = sorys
access_code = ac_9ba40c
host = sorwyn.ordingrid.local
port = 5000
owner = aldok.quenion
peer = belath.paliqcloud.local

New starter checklist — cleaning-crew access (reception copy). Each evening the Pellworth Cleaning team arrives between 18:00 and 18:30 and signs in at the front desk. Check each cleaner's name against the roster in the blue folder, issue a visitor lanyard, and note the time in the log. The crew needs access to the service corridor behind the lifts, which stays locked during business hours. Once the roster check is done, unlock the corridor door for them using the pass code below.

turnstile pass: bdg-NZJSS-18109

Attendees: R. Calloway, M. Brask, T. Idrena. Chair: Calloway.

Decision: Retire the Lanternis product line effective Q3. Support contracts honored through year-end; no new licenses sold after June. Migration path to Corvelle Suite approved. Two engineers reassigned to the Halwick facility; remainder absorbed by platform teams.

Finance to model write-down of remaining Lanternis inventory by next session. Customer notices drafted by Brask, pending legal sign-off.

The rationale tied to our forward roadmap is summarized in the note below.

confidential, bahof-yaweg: Headcount on the Kaseth team goes from 32 to 109 by the end of January. Gross margin on Kaseth came in at 46 percent against a plan of 45 percent.

# Break-Glass: Catalog Cache Invalidation

Scope: the Pinrow product catalog at Veldstone Retail. If stale prices persist after a purge and the Hollowmere invalidation queue is wedged, use break-glass to flush the edge tier directly. Contractors: get verbal sign-off from the catalog lead first. Steps: open the Hollowmere admin shell, select emergency-flush, confirm the tenant, and run it once — repeated flushes thrash the origin. Access is logged and expires after 20 minutes. Unseal the admin shell with the passphrase below.

recovery phrase for kahop-tajog: istix-casvan